Now Is the Age of Judgment Between Life and Death *Dojeon 2:40

1 Commenting upon a saying passed down through generations—‘For every one hundred ancestors, only one descendant survives’—Sangjenim declared,

2 “When the autumn wind blows, leaves fall and fruit ripens.

3 Now is the age of judgment between life and death.”

The Coming Catastrophes of the World
4 One day, a disciple asked Sangjenim, “There is a saying, ‘People do not know that the coming catastrophes of the world are due to the spirits’ creation-transformation.’ Is this saying indeed true?”
5 Sangjenim revealed, “Even the gaebyeok of heaven and earth cannot be accomplished without the spirits, for no undertaking can be realized without the participation of the spirits.

6 My world shall be the world of creation-transformation, for it shall be the world in which spirits and humans become one.”
7 Sangjenim also declared, “My work shall be accomplished through the union of humans and spirits.”

 

Heaven and earth perpetually repeat the process of giving life in spring and taking life in autumn. Giving life in spring, taking life in autumn! Giving life, taking life! Heaven and earth labor to bring this to pass, never resting for a single second, never for a single moment.


The Autumn Gaebyeok does not signify that people will slay each other. Rather, heaven and earth will strike down humanity in accordance with the principle of ‘giving life in spring and taking life in autumn.’ This is akin to the way that the frost and snow of the earth year’s autumn desiccate vegetation without the sparing of even a blade of grass.


When the Autumn Gaebyeok occurs, only the seeds of those who should live will survive, while multitudes of human beings shall perish like falling leaves. This is a major characteristic of the Autumn Gaebyeok. Although humans are born in cosmic spring and are raised throughout cosmic summer, the growth process is abruptly brought to a halt in cosmic autumn. Just as the heavy frost of a single autumn morning kills grass at a single stroke, in autumn the autumn energy takes away many lives in a single stroke.
